Austin Photography Workshops

AzulOx Workshops are Austin Photography Workshops. Our goal is to teach, demonstrate and nurture specific photography skills with cameras and gear in your hands. Workshops are limited to a small number of participants to maximize your learning time and access to the instructors.

Our instructors are working professional photographers, models and other specialist. Their goal is to maximize your learning and enjoyment.
